Description

2 Francs from Belgium. Issued from 1910 to 1912. Struck in Silver (.835) (16.5% copper). Measures 27 mm and weighs 10 g.

Obverse
The portrait in left profile of the King Albert I is surrounded with the French legend. Designer below. (Albert, King of the Belgians)
Reverse
The face value and date are surrounded with an olive branch and oak branch and the motto in French. (Unity Makes Strength)
Edge
Reeded
